brag to speak in a way that is too proud about something you do or have.
breathe to take air into and out of the lungs.
due required or expected to arrive.
float to rest on the surface of a liquid without sinking.
fuel anything such as wood or gasoline that is burned as a source of energy.
greet to use words or simple actions that show pleasure or respect when you meet someone or start a letter.
inner located inside.
legend a story or group of stories that have been handed down from a time long ago and that many people in a society know but cannot prove to be true or untrue.
object anything that has shape or form and can be seen or touched.
plenty a full amount or supply.
replace to put something in the place of another thing.
set to put in a particular place.
slice to take from a larger portion by cutting.
straight without a curve or bend.
voice the sound that comes from your mouth when you speak or sing.
